JP Walker. Journalism degree, a decade-plus in restaurant kitchens, and a self-taught habit of taking things apart until they work. These days that means Linux boxes, a growing homelab, home automation, soldering irons, and a 3D printer that runs more than I do.

This site is the workshop notebook: what I'm building, what broke, and what I learned fixing it. It's also me deliberately walking out of the kitchen and toward IT and technical writing — one documented project at a time.
